打印

CAN总线加上120欧姆电阻就无法通信

[复制链接]
8785|16
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
白牙丶|  楼主 | 2021-8-17 13:18 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
用TJA1050按照网上电路加上120欧姆电阻,但是无法通信,后来去掉电阻就能通信,这是什么原因?总线很短只是做实验。

使用特权

评论回复

相关帖子

沙发
LcwSwust| | 2021-8-17 13:32 | 只看该作者
先拿万用表测下除了这只120欧是否还有其它电阻。
若并联电阻导致总电阻过小,可能就驱不动了。

使用特权

评论回复
评论
白牙丶 2021-8-17 13:51 回复TA
CANL和CANH之间有一个25欧姆电阻,这是TJA1050内部自带的吧 
板凳
资深技术| | 2021-8-17 13:51 | 只看该作者
如果电路没问题,可能是输出芯片驱动不够,或是接收芯片有问题。这个只有通过测试和实验找出原因

使用特权

评论回复
地板
LcwSwust| | 2021-8-17 13:59 | 只看该作者
注意单位,有个K

使用特权

评论回复
评论
tyw 2021-8-17 15:03 回复TA
@LcwSwust :ok,ha,ha 
LcwSwust 2021-8-17 14:57 回复TA
@tyw :是的,这是回复楼主在13:51的回复,由于直接点击“回复”无法发图片,所以发到下面了。 内部自带两个25K欧电阻,不知楼主所说“CANL和CANH之间有一个25欧姆电阻”是把单位整错了还是别的地方真有这么小的电阻。 
tyw 2021-8-17 14:50 回复TA
这个好象在芯片内部的 
5
tyw| | 2021-8-17 14:32 | 只看该作者
PCA82C250-251 TJA1040 TJA1050.pdf (372.63 KB)
TJA1050 CAN 高速收发器应用指南说明.pdf (566.41 KB)
TJA1050 高速CAN收发器.pdf (88.31 KB)

使用特权

评论回复
6
lfc315| | 2021-8-17 15:06 | 只看该作者
会不会装成12欧了;
如果元件没问题,估计是电源带负载能力不行吧

使用特权

评论回复
7
autodash| | 2021-8-17 15:11 | 只看该作者
先说你的波特率多少? 脱开波特率说电阻就是胡闹

使用特权

评论回复
评论
白牙丶 2021-8-17 15:15 回复TA
波特率是500KBPS 
8
白牙丶|  楼主 | 2021-8-17 15:14 | 只看该作者

CAN总线加上120欧姆电阻就无法通信

试验了下,120欧电阻没问题,是在TJA1050的TX RX接了电容,导致无法通讯。

使用特权

评论回复
评论
chunyang 2021-9-4 20:48 回复TA
为何要接电容?那是一定会影响通迅的。 
9
LcwSwust| | 2021-8-17 15:22 | 只看该作者
白牙丶 发表于 2021-8-17 15:14
试验了下,120欧电阻没问题,是在TJA1050的TX RX接了电容,导致无法通讯。

好吧,竟是因为电容。

使用特权

评论回复
评论
睡觉的懒猫 2021-9-4 18:01 回复TA
是的,我遇到过到这种情况,超过5台有问题 
10
申小林一号| | 2021-8-18 08:47 | 只看该作者
电阻是两端都要加,总线的匹配电阻在60欧姆左右

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1

主题

4

帖子

0

粉丝